Output 64523416ad95bfc167d5443fbd8317599a0e72c02d07c7b40772a2ad0c7c2d30:6

value
26829110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f401e606449e3c2edef590bd77aa65dffe90b8f OP_EQUAL
address
MRLQ77Txvf7y4FQkF6znXcggcb8ZjPMTTa
transaction
64523416ad95bfc167d5443fbd8317599a0e72c02d07c7b40772a2ad0c7c2d30
spent
true